The first pharmaceutical product commercially manufactured using recombinant DNA technology, by Eli Lilly in 1979, was:

AHuman growth hormone
BHepatitis B vaccine
CTissue plasminogen activator
DHuman insulin
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: D. Human insulin
1. Several proteins such as insulin, growth hormone and vaccines are made by rDNA technique. 2. The text states Eli Lilly first started commercial production of human insulin using rDNA technology in 1979. 3. The other products were also developed by rDNA but are not named as the first commercial one, so A, B and C are traps. 4. Hence the answer is D. _Source: Samacheer Kalvi (TN SCERT) Class 10 Science, Unit "Breeding and Biotechnology", p.300_
